Telehealth Therapy: Digital Psychiatry Services
Telehealth therapy has revolutionized the way psychiatric services are delivered, allowing individuals to receive mental health care remotely via digital platforms. This service is particularly beneficial for those who have limited access to traditional in-person therapy due to geographical, physical, or time constraints. Digital psychiatry services include consultations, therapy sessions, and follow-up care, all conducted through secure video conferencing tools, ensuring privacy and convenience.
Trauma Recovery: Hope Beyond the Pain
Trauma recovery services are dedicated to helping individuals who have experienced traumatic events such as abuse, accidents, or natural disasters. These services focus on helping survivors cope with the immediate and long-term effects of trauma through specialized therapies like trauma-focused cognitive behavioral therapy (TF-CBT) and eye movement des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R). The goal is to provide a safe space for individuals to process their experiences and find hope beyond the pain.

Sleep Disorder Treatment: Falling Asleep Naturally
Sleep disorder treatment services address various conditions that disrupt normal sleep patterns, such as insomnia, sleep apnea, and restless legs syndrome. These services offer a combination of medical treatment, lifestyle changes, and counseling to help individuals achieve restful and natural sleep. The focus is on identifying and treating the underlying causes of sleep disturbances, promoting better overall health and well-being.

Autism Support: Fine Motor Support for Autism
Autism support services include specialized programs that help individuals with autism spectrum disorders improve their fine motor skills. These services often involve occupational therapy, which focuses on enhancing daily living skills, and physical therapy, which aims to improve coordination and motor function. The goal is to support individuals with autism in achieving greater independence and quality of life through tailored interventions.
